Strategy Agri-Biz & Commodities - Tea Girnar plans foray into TN tea market R.Y. Narayanan
Coimbatore , Nov. 3 THE Girnar group, which has a strong presence in the retail tea market in Maharashtra, is making a foray into Tamil Nadu through direct sales outlets and channel partners. The company finds the Tamil Nadu tea market one of the fastest growing in the country with tea consumption growing by about 5 per cent to 6 per cent. Mr Hemant J. Shah, Director, Girnar Food and Beverages Pvt Ltd, Coimbatore, told Business Line that the group has an annual turnover of about Rs 150 crore. While 60 per cent of it came from exports, the balance was from domestic sales. Tea remained the major product marketed by the company, apart from coffee and other agricultural commodities. Mr Shah said the company had been present in Maharashtra for more than three decades and "almost achieved our targets" there and the current moment was the "right time to expand." He saw huge potential in the Tamil Nadu tea market, which was "rapidly growing." Mr Shah said in Coimbatore, the company was looking to have outlets on important highways like Avanashi road, Tiruchi road, Mettupalayam road apart from Gandhipuram and R.S. Puram areas. . Girnar hopes to cover important cities including Chennai, Madurai, Tiruchi, Salem and Erode in a phased manner.
